Trusting and Knowing God 7/1/09

20 Now what more can David say to You? For You, Lord God, know Your servant.

21 For Your word's sake, and according to Your own heart, You have done all these great things, to make Your servant know them.

22 Therefore You are great, O Lord God. For there is none like You, nor is there any God besides You

2 Sam 7:20-22 (NKJV)



As David knew, God knows everything about us. He knew all about us before we were just a dot in our mother's womb. He knew all the plans, thoughts, and desires that we would have throughout our entire life. He, God of the universe, Maker of all, desired to have a wonderful relationship with us if we choose to have one with Him. But it isn't enough to want or to choose to have a relationship with God, as it is to believe and put your trust in Him.



I'm not specifically talking about salvation. I'm talking about a daily spiritual battle where we have to choose who we're going to follow. Will we follow the own foolish dictates of our heart? Or will we trust God?
